Longview Firefighters Battle Massive Warehouse Blaze on South Green Street

Longview, Texas - Late Sunday night, November 2, 2025, Longview firefighters responded to a large commercial structure fire at 732 S. Green Street.

Crews were dispatched at approximately 11:29 p.m. and arrived to find a vacant warehouse fully involved, with heavy flames and smoke showing through the roof. Battalion Chief 1 quickly confirmed the structure was already collapsing, creating dangerous conditions for firefighters on scene.

Due to the instability of the building, command shifted operations to a defensive strategy and requested a second alarm for additional personnel and equipment. Firefighters used aerial apparatus to knock down the main body of fire while handlines targeted remaining hot spots from outside the structure.

Once the fire was contained, crews conducted a search and confirmed no occupants were inside. The estimated damage to the property is about $72,740. Fortunately, no injuries were reported.

The cause of the fire remains under investigation. Anyone with information is encouraged to contact the Longview Fire Department at 903-237-1119 or Gregg County Crime Stoppers at 903-236-7867.

In total, the Longview Fire Department responded with five engines, three ladder trucks, two ambulances, and four support vehicles, totaling 32 personnel. The department extended special thanks to the West Harrison, White Oak, Elderville-Lakeport, and Judson Fire Departments for their assistance during the incident.
